The controversial Timed Out dismissal of Angelo Mathews from the Sri Lanka vs Bangladesh game of the ICC ODI World Cup 2023 is still making waves and has emanated the funny side of Chris Woakes on the field. Amid all the row over Mathews' contentious departure, the matter carried forward to match number 40, where something similar of the sort took place. This time everything was intended and done in a satirical tone.

3 things you need to know

  • England defeated the Netherlands by 160 runs in match number 40 of the ICC ODI World Cup 2023
  • Ben Stokes scored a century to play an instrumental role in the victory
  • Chris Woakes also contributed with a 51-run innings to take England out of the danger zone

Chris Woakes jokes about Angelo Mathews' Timed Out dismissal

In match number 40 of the ICC ODI World Cup 2023, England once again found themselves in a spot of bother, however, Chris Woakes stepped up and played a formidable role with the bat to build a crucial 129-run stand for the 8th wicket. The partnership transported England from a troublesome situation to a comfortable position in the match.

Advertisement

Ahead of the superior Strokeplay showcased by both batters, there came a moment when it was all laughs on the ground. At the time of his arrival, Woakes showcased a broken helmet strap to the umpire to avoid getting timed out. He had a big smile on his face bringing into attention what had transpired the day before yesterday.

Angelo Mathews' controversial dismissal

It should be noted that Angelo Mathews became the first-ever player to be given Timed Out in the match. His dismissal became the bearer of controversy as he claims he was in the center within the permissible duration, yet was given out. Mathews showcased his broken helmet strap to reason why it took longer for him to take the guard. However, the on-field officials remained unfazed after Shakib Al Hasan's appeal and directed him to leave the field.
